Group Sessions

show all

Monday 06/04/2026

Monday 06/04/2026

1030-1200
Court 1
12 places left: book now
£2.00
mycourts ® is a Registered Trademark of HBI Consulting Ltd
Copyright © 2005-2026 HBI Consulting Ltd